Long Brick Workout Design: 4-Hour Ride + 1-Hour Run to Prepare for IM 226

Ironman 226 (3.8km swim + 180km bike + 42.2km run) takes 9–14 hours in total, pushing endurance sports to its limits. The long Brick is an indispensable key workout—it trains not only your fitness, but also your fueling, your mind, and your body’s ability to perform after 5 hours.

1. Training Goals of the Long Brick

  1. Endurance stacking: Accumulate long-duration aerobic endurance
  2. Fueling strategy testing: Find a race-day fueling plan that actually works
  3. Heart rate drift management: Learn to hold your target pace even after 4 hours
  4. Mental tolerance: Get used to the “tired but keep going” state
  5. Gear testing: Discovering problems on race day is too late

2. Standard Long Brick Workout

4-Hour Ride + 1-Hour Run (Core IM-Distance Race Prep Workout)

Time Segment Content Heart Rate Zone Pace/Power Target
0:00–0:15 Bike warm-up Z1 (60–65%) 70% FTP
0:15–2:30 Main ride 1 Z2 (70–75%) 75% FTP
2:30–2:35 Short stop for fueling Water + gel
2:35–4:00 Main ride 2 Z2 (70–75%) 75% FTP, heart rate drift up to 5% allowed
4:00–4:08 Transition (including fueling) Grab water bottle, put on cap, change shoes
4:08–5:08 Run main set Z2–Z3 (75–82%) 15 sec/km slower than IM target pace

Total time: 5 hours 8 minutes, matching the IM race segment split.

3. Fueling Strategy (5-Hour Long Brick)

Bike Segment (4 Hours)

Time Fueling Content Calories Carbohydrates
0:30 1 energy bar 220 kcal 35g
1:00 1 gel + 200ml sports drink 150 kcal 35g
1:30 Half a banana + 200ml water 60 kcal 15g
2:00 1 gel + 200ml sports drink 150 kcal 35g
2:30 1 energy bar + 1 salt tablet 220 kcal 35g
3:00 1 gel + 200ml sports drink 150 kcal 35g
3:30 200ml cola (caffeine, sugar-free) 80 kcal 22g
Subtotal 1030 kcal 212g

Approximately 53g of carbohydrates and 260 kcal per hour—this is the standard IM race-day ration.

Run Segment (1 Hour)

Time Fueling Content Calories
0:20 Gel + 100ml water 100 kcal
0:40 Gel + 100ml sports drink 100 kcal

Fuel every 20 minutes during the run segment to avoid excessive stomach pressure.

4. Heart Rate Drift Control

Prolonged exercise causes “cardiac drift”: power output stays the same, but heart rate keeps rising. Causes include dehydration, rising body temperature, and glycogen depletion. Acceptable drift range:

Time Starting HR Ending HR Drift
0–1 hour 140 bpm 142 bpm 1.4% (normal)
1–2 hours 142 bpm 145 bpm 2.1% (normal)
2–3 hours 145 bpm 150 bpm 3.4% (caution)
3–4 hours 150 bpm 156 bpm 4% (warning)

If drift exceeds 5%, check: whether hydration is sufficient (500–700ml per hour), whether carbohydrate intake is on track, and whether body temperature is too high.

5. Run Segment Pacing Strategy

After riding for 4 hours, the 1-hour run is not about “how fast you can run,” but “whether you can hold your race target pace.”

IM Marathon Target Brick Run Pace
4:00 (5:41/km) 6:00–6:15/km
4:30 (6:24/km) 6:45–7:00/km
5:00 (7:07/km) 7:30–7:45/km

If the Brick run pace is more than 30 sec/km slower than expected, it means the bike intensity was too high or fueling was insufficient.

6. 12-Week Training Cycle

Week Brick Content
W1–W2 2-hour ride + 30-minute run (adaptation phase)
W3–W4 2.5 hours + 40 minutes
W5–W6 3 hours + 45 minutes
W7–W8 3.5 hours + 50 minutes
W9–W10 4 hours + 1 hour (peak)
W11 3 hours + 45 minutes (taper)
W12 (race week) 1.5 hours + 20 minutes (maintain feel)

7. Recovery After the Long Brick

  • 0–30 minutes: Consume 80g carbohydrates + 25g protein
  • 30–120 minutes: Full meal, focusing on electrolytes and glycogen
  • 2–6 hours: 30 minutes of easy walking / foam rolling
  • 24 hours: Light recovery ride or swim
  • 48 hours: Avoid high-intensity training

The long Brick is the most demanding workout in IM race prep, but after completing it 2–3 times, your confidence on race day will be completely different.
